The equation used to predict college GPA (range 0-4.0) is y=0.21 + 0.53 x 1 + 0.002 x 2,where x1is high school GPA (range 0-4.0) and x2is college board score (range 200-800). Use the multiple regression equation to predict college GPA for a high school GPA of 3.7and a college board score of 600.
The predicted college GPA for a high school GPA of 3.7
and a college board score of 600is ____________ (Round to the nearest tenth as needed.)
